Minimal reproducible test for this error message: /usr/lib/haxe/std/sys/db/Object.hx:29: characters 2-11 : You cannot use @:build inside a macro : make sure that your enum is not used in macro

import haxe.macro.Expr; | |
import haxe.macro.Context; | |
import neko.Lib; | |
class BuildInMacroTests { | |
public static function main() { | |
var s:MyModel = new MyModel(); | |
Formatter.__Output_Formatter( s ); | |
} | |
} | |
class MyModel extends sys.db.Object | |
{ | |
var id:Int; | |
var name:String; | |
} | |
private class Formatter { | |
public static macro function __Output_Formatter(output : Expr) : Expr { | |
return output; | |
} | |
} |
You can also wrap "MyModel" and "BuildInMacroTests" in #if !macro ... #end
conditionals which also resolves the issue.
